Financial Performance - Total operating revenue for the first half of 2015 was CNY 468,743,566.06, representing a 70.53% increase compared to CNY 274,867,118.66 in the same period last year[17]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company was CNY 27,626,535.92, a decrease of 10.58% from CNY 30,896,652.33 in the previous year[17]. - Basic earnings per share decreased by 23.08% to CNY 0.10 from CNY 0.13 in the previous year[17]. - The company reported a decrease in net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ses, which was CNY 24,539,044.62, down 5.94% from CNY 26,088,181.18[17]. - The total comprehensive income for the first half of 2015 was CNY 28,583,276.92, compared to CNY 31,823,587.81 in the previous year, reflecting a decrease of about 10.5%[163]. - The company reported a significant decrease in other payables from CNY 44,122,156.63 to CNY 10,010,493.81, a decline of about 77.32%[158]. - The total amount of raised funds is CNY 57,784.67 million, with CNY 10,948.55 million invested during the reporting period[62]. Cash Flow and Liquidity - Net cash flow from operating activities was negative CNY 48,204,838.64, worsening by 44.66% compared to negative CNY 33,323,872.00 in the same period last year[17]. - Cash and cash equivalents decreased from CNY 313,952,887.40 to CNY 88,838,140.48, a decline of approximately 71.75%[157]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was -48,204,838.64 yuan, compared to -33,323,872.00 yuan in the previous period, indicating a decline in operational cash generation[170]. - The total c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period decreased to 180,977,978.66 yuan from 448,791,861.20 yuan, indicating a significant cash depletion[171]. - The company received 105,000,000.00 yuan in borrowings during the financing activities, down from 421,000,000.00 yuan in the previous period, suggesting reduced access to financing[171]. Investment and R&D - R&D investment increased by 123.32% to 49.74 million yuan, reflecting the company's commitment to enhancing its R&D capabilities[38]. - The company is committed to enhancing its R&D capabilities to ensure the successful development of new products, which is critical for maintaining market competitiveness[27]. - The company has initiated research and development for new products, aiming to enhance its competitive edge in the software industry[182]. - The company has established a comprehensive human resources system to mitigate the risk of core employee turnover[59]. Market Strategy and Expansion - The company is focusing on expanding its international market presence, particularly in North America and Southeast Asia, while also strengthening its domestic market efforts to mitigate market risks[23]. - The company emphasizes a strategy of "internationalization, specialization, and high-end development" to leverage its technological and talent advantages[51]. - The company has actively pursued mergers and acquisitions, notably acquiring Jieke Zhicheng to enhance its financial information technology services[45]. Risks and Challenges - Rising labor costs pose a risk to profit margins, as the company relies heavily on skilled personnel; it plans to mitigate this by increasing project outsourcing and improving employee efficiency[26]. - The company faces risks related to accounts receivable collection due to the lengthy project cycles, and it has established policies to mitigate potential bad debt losses[30]. - Currency exchange rate fluctuations significantly impact the company's financial performance, particularly in its international software outsourcing business, and it is taking steps to manage this risk[32]. - Management risks are associated with the company's expansion and acquisitions, necessitating improvements in management systems and talent acquisition[29]. Shareholder and Governance - The company plans not to distribute cash dividends or issue bonus shares for the half-year period[77]. - The company has established a complete decision-making process for profit distribution, ensuring the protection of minority shareholders' rights[76]. - The independent directors have fulfilled their responsibilities and provided independent opinions on the profit distribution plan[77]. - The company has committed to reducing and standardizing related transactions, ensuring that no funds will be occupied through loans or other means by related parties[106]. Financial Position -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 2,188,619,486.84, down 3.36% from CNY 2,264,744,043.31 at the end of the previous year[17]. - The company's total equity attributable to shareholders increased by 1.02% to CNY 1,474,307,752.49 from CNY 1,459,458,040.69 at the end of the previous year[17]. - Owner's equity increased from CNY 1,493,923,214.09 to CNY 1,509,859,613.61, an increase of about 1.20%[155]. Capital and Financial Structure - The registered capital of Jiangsu Hoperun Software Co., Ltd. increased to 273.67 million yuan following an asset restructuring on September 22, 2014[18]. - The company reported a registered capital of 284.62 million yuan after a stock incentive plan on January 15, 2015[18]. - The total number of newly issued shares was 43,446,774, increasing the total share capital from ¥230.22 million to ¥273.67 million[128]. - The company’s total share capital was adjusted to reflect the new shares issued, impacting the overall equity structure[179]. - The company’s capital reserve at the end of 2013 was RMB 340,369,049.73, with a plan to increase total share capital to 230,220,000 shares through a bonus share distribution of 5 shares for every 10 shares held[90].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2014 was ¥733,234,727.46, representing a 53.78% increase compared to ¥476,797,826.03 in 2013[21]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2014 was ¥110,029,056.96, a 42.58% increase from ¥77,167,961.05 in 2013[21]. - The operating cash flow for 2014 was ¥48,004,020.35, showing a significant increase of 97.55% from ¥24,300,211.61 in 2013[21]. - The total assets at the end of 2014 reached ¥2,264,744,043.31, a 107.11% increase from ¥1,093,508,526.09 in 2013[21]. - The total liabilities at the end of 2014 were ¥770,820,829.22, which is a 119.40% increase compared to ¥351,337,232.14 in 2013[21]. Revenue Breakdown - The company achieved operating revenue of 733.23 million yuan, an increase of 53.78% compared to the previous year[40]. - The net profit reached 114.35 million yuan, reflecting a growth of 46.52% year-on-year[40]. - Main business revenue was 730.18 million yuan, a 53.75% increase year-on-year, accounting for 99.58% of total revenue[41]. - International business revenue reached 156.10 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 20.44%, accounting for 21.29% of total revenue; domestic business revenue was 574.08 million yuan, up 66.26%, accounting for 78.29% of total revenue[44]. - Software business revenue amounted to 538.29 million yuan, a growth of 55.63% year-on-year, representing 73.41% of total revenue; system integration service revenue was 103.90 million yuan, up 79.49% year-on-year, accounting for 14.17% of total revenue[44]. Research and Development - R&D investment was 67.75 million yuan, accounting for 9.24% of total revenue, primarily focused on developing proprietary software products[54]. - The company plans to enhance R&D investment and maintain technological advancement to ensure competitive edge[32]. - The company plans to continue investing in R&D to enhance its core competitiveness and meet the growing market demand for software services[54].
